8 View System Log & Status
Route Information: Select "Route Information" on the drop-down list to display route
table.WIAS-3200N v2 could be used as a L2 or L3 device. It doesn't support dynamic
routing protocols such as RIP or OSPF. Static routes to specific hosts, networks or
default gateway are set up automatically according to the IP configuration of system's
interfaces. When used as a L2 device, it could switch packets and, as L3 device, it's
capable of being a gateway to route packets inward and outward.
ARP Table Information: Select "ARP Table Information" on the drop-down list to
display ARP table. ARP associates each IP address to a unique hardware address
(MAC) of a device. It is important to have a unique IP address as final destination to
switch packets to.
Bridge Table Information: Select "Bridge Table Information" on the drop-down list
to display bridge table. Bridge table will show Bridge ID and STP's Status on the each
Ethernet bridge and its attached interfaces, the Bridge Port should be attached to
some interfaces (e.g. eth0, eth0.vlan_tag, ath0~ath7).
